Many people that I talk to do not find a college education to be very important. I come from a family that has never had anyone, which I can link to in my family tree, graduate from college. I come from a place where the oilfield has taken over the town and people are simply blinded by the money in it. With experience in the construction business people tell me several times a day that going to college is not worth the time or money, and that some day starting my own construction company is the way to go. The more I hear the more I could not disagree. My firm belief is simply this, a college education allows you to do something you enjoy, in the long run the pay and the benefits are greater, and knowledge is power.
